Poor oral hygiene: Learn about the role of inadequate brushing, flossing, and tongue cleaning in causing bad breath.
Dental issues: Explore how cavities, gum disease, and oral infections contribute to halitosis.
Dry mouth: Discover the impact of reduced saliva production on bad breath and its connection to certain medications or medical conditions.
Proper brushing techniques:Get insights on how to brush your teeth effectively, including brushing the tongue, to eliminate odor-causing bacteria.
Flossing and mouthwash: Explore the significance of flossing and using mouthwash as crucial steps in maintaining fresh breath.
Regular dental check-ups: Learn about the importance of professional cleanings and examinations to detect and address any underlying dental issues.
